Which process describes erosion at the base of a cliff caused by wave action, leading to undercutting?

Explanation:
When waves attack the base of a cliff, they remove rock right at the foot, carving a notch in the rock. This focused erosion at the base is called undercutting. The energy of the sea at the cliff foot, combined with processes like hydraulic action and abrasion, wears away the base and creates that overhanging part. Over time, the unsupported upper rock becomes unstable and can collapse, continuing the cliff retreat. Abrasion is one mechanism that helps wear away rock, but it’s not the name for the base-notch process itself. Weathering is rock breakdown in place, not the transport and removal by wave action. Erosion is the broad idea of wearing away by natural forces, but the specific base-notch action caused by waves is undercutting.
